Macbook 4.1, A1181, 2008
I've searched and checked previous pages for an answer, no joy.
My Macbook makes an odd 'plink' noise every now and then. I've tried timing it to see if it's related to battery charge level, because I run the MB from the adaptor most of the time. The noise comes from the upper right corner of the MB base, in the region of the power on/off button.
Is this a normal operating noise; or to what might it be related?
Update - the noise is occurring every twenty minutes.
